Molecular Geometry

The three-dimensional arrangement of the bonded atoms in a molecule, ignoring the positions of lone pairs.

In depth

Molecular geometry is obtained by taking the electron domain geometry and deleting the lone pair positions, which is why ammonia is described as pyramidal rather than tetrahedral. Shape determines polarity, packing, biological recognition and reactivity, making it one of the most consequential facts about a molecule.

Examples in the real world

Water is bent rather than tetrahedral; SF₄ is see-saw rather than trigonal bipyramidal.
